I don't have a vita but am looking to buy one I have two questions 1 is it the size of a psp or a nowaday smartphone 2 is it light or heavy Like is it comfortable to hold in your hands? Please and thank you
1. It's slightly larger than a PSP. 2. It's slightly heavier than your common smartphone. 3. This is dependent on the person, but most find it very comfortable.
It is slightly bigger than a psp. The 2000/3000 models are very light. And the comfortability all depends on your hand size. If you have bigger hands, I recommend getting a vita grip for under $20, makes the experience much better.
It's larger than a psp but slightly slimmer and still fits right into a pocket. I would compare it to a Samsung Galaxy Ultra versions. For the weight, it would depend if you have the newer plastic models that come with different colors or the OG black one with a aluminum border. But it's weight adds to the comfortability of the console I feel like. Which gets me to the next part. The grips are really good. They do not have a flat back but they have these groves that your finger slide into and allow for a tighter grip. The best part of the Vita are the joysticks and the touch pads. It gave developers alot of features to test out and many of the games that do use them are probably my favorites
